★ A bold stater from Larissa ★

THESSALY. Larissa. Circa 356-342 BC. Stater (Silver, 23 mm, 12.24 g, 5 h). Head of the nymph Larissa facing slightly to left, wearing ampyx, pendant earring and necklace. Rev. ΛΑΡΙΣ-ΑΙΩΝ / M Bridled horse walking right. BCD Thessaly I 1159. BCD Thessaly II 306 ( same dies ). A bold and clear example of excellent style. Struck on a slightly short flan as usual and with very light die rust on the obverse, otherwise, extremely fine.

From a German collection, assembled since the 1960s.
